Digital Transformation in the Food Service Industry
Digital transformation has revolutionized the food service industry in various ways, enhancing efficiency, customer experience, and operational processes. Some key aspects of digital transformation in this field include:
1. Online Ordering and Delivery
Restaurants have adopted online ordering systems and delivery services to reach a wider customer base and provide convenience. This has become increasingly important, especially in the wake of the COVID-19 pandemic.
2. Mobile Apps
Many food service businesses have developed mobile apps to streamline ordering, payment, loyalty programs, and personalized promotions. These apps enhance customer engagement and retention.
3. Data Analytics
Utilizing data analytics helps restaurants understand customer preferences, optimize menu offerings, manage inventory efficiently, and forecast demand accurately. This data-driven approach can lead to better decision-making.
4. Automation and Robotics
Automation technologies like self-service kiosks, robotic kitchen assistants, and inventory management systems have improved operational efficiency and reduced costs for food service establishments.
5. IoT and Smart Kitchen Appliances
Internet of Things (IoT) devices and smart kitchen appliances enable remote monitoring, control, and automation of kitchen operations, leading to improved quality, consistency, and safety in food preparation.
6. Digital Marketing and Social Media
Food businesses leverage digital marketing strategies and social media platforms to engage with customers, promote their brand, showcase menu items, and gather feedback, enhancing their online presence and reputation.
Digital transformation continues to reshape the food service industry, offering new opportunities for growth, innovation, and sustainability.
